Overview Credence Management Solutions, LLC (Credence) is seeking a Personnel Manager to support one of Credence's premier space programs where we are providing a broad range of acquisition capabilities and integrated program management solutions. This work will encompass space related research, development, production, operations & maintenance, and lifecycle acquisition activities directly impacting the Military Communication (MilComm) and Positioning, Navigation, and Timing (PNT) Directorate. Salary Range Full salary range for this position is $140,000 to $250,000 per year, with the starting salary determined based on candidate's knowledge, skills, experience, as well as budget availability.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to the duties listed below * Provide Directorate level support for infrastructure, human resources, and personnel management * Responsible for overseeing the following organizational support services functions: * Automated Data Processing Equipment Management * Track all assigned hardware and ensure hand receipts are signed for * Perform semi-annual inventory of all items and equipment * Coordinate equipment transfers * Manage routine maintenance schedule on equipment * Base help desk coordinaiion for hardware malfunctions * Execute the transition and maintenance of a standard functional database * Infrastructure Management * Manage monthly building occupancy and analyze space requirements * Coordinate and facilitate monthly facility board meetings * Communicate any ongoing requirements * Meet and communicate with all 3-letter and 4-letter organizations * Education, Professional Development & Recognition Program * Plan, organize, and evaluate the organizations training and professional development program * Interact with DOD and vendor training offerors * Track and process government ethics 450 * Unit Deployment, Readiness and Self-Assessment Program * Monitor and track deploying personnel and equipment and complete applicable documentation * Track, monitor and coordinate equipment purchasing * Comply with management internal control toolset database policies * Manage the task management tool and organizational inbox daily while delegating resposibilties. * Performance Management * Track military performance reports, feedback forms, military promotion forms, stratifications, and force shaping forms * Prepare packages for review prior to stratification boards * Monitor performance deadlines and drive completion * Manpower, Personnel, and Information Management * Maintain unit personnel management roster, organizational charts, unit manning document, and related organizational rosters related to personnel management activities. * Ensure compliance across Air Force / Space Force instructions * Cooridnate with COR on prioritization of positions and requisiton forms * Provide analysis of overall unit military manning * Assist with Interviews, interview board prep, and personnel tracking Education, Requirements and Qualifications * DoD Secret security clearance is required * BA/BS in a relevant field is required, MA/MS degree is preferred * PMP certification is preferred * Ten plus (10+) years demonstrated relevant experience is required * Planning, directing, or coordinating human resources activities and staff of an organization
